在现代网站建设中,提升网站加载速度和优化用户体验一直是站长们追求的目标。在这方面,内容分发网络(CDN)是一个强有力的工具。本文将详细介绍如何在WordPress网站中开启和使用CDN,通过逐步指导帮助网站管理员最大化利用CDN技术。
CDN的基本概念与优势 在深入CDN的具体实现过程之前,了解CDN的基本概念和其带来的优势是十分必要的。
什么是CDN?
内容分发网络(CDN)是由分布在各地的服务器网络组成的系统。这些服务器共同致力于将网页内容,包括图像、JavaScript、CSS文件等,加速分发到用户手中。通过将资源存储在离用户地理位置最近的服务器上,CDN提高了网站的加载速度,降低了加载延迟。
使用CDN的优势
提高网站性能:通过将资源分发到离用户最近的服务器,CDN减少了数据传输的距离,进而缩短了加载时间。 增强网站可靠性:CDN提供冗余服务器集,可以在某服务器点故障时无缝切换,保证网站持续可用。 节省带宽成本:由于大量流量通过CDN而非原宿主服务器传输,使用CDN可以减少带宽使用及相关费用。 改善SEO排名:搜索引擎偏好加载速度快的网站,使用CDN优化了网站速度,有助于SEO。 提高安全性:许多CDN提供附加安全保护功能,如DDoS防御和SSL加密。
WordPress集成CDN的前期准备 在实施CDN之前,需要做好一些准备工作。
选择合适的CDN服务商
市场上有许多CDN服务商可供选择,如Cloudflare、Amazon CloudFront、Akamai等。选择时需考量以下几个因素:
地理节点覆盖范围:确保选择的CDN在目标客户群体所在地区有良好的节点覆盖。 服务价格:了解服务定价模式,根据需求选择适合的方案。 附加功能:一些CDN提供兼备缓存清理、SSL、分流等功能,根据需要选择。
备份网站数据
在对WordPress网站进行重大设置更改(如集成CDN)之前,备份网站数据是确保安全的重要步骤。可以使用WordPress备份插件如UpdraftPlus、BackWPup等,定期保存完整的网站数据。
WordPress如何集成CDN 将CDN集成到WordPress涉及多个步骤,以下将分步讲解。
安装和配置必要插件
选择CDN支持插件:WP Super Cache和W3 Total Cache是WordPress常用的缓存插件,支持简单的CDN集成。 插件安装:
登录WordPress后台,进入“插件”页面,点击“添加插件”。 搜索并安装所选插件,如W3 Total Cache。
CDN设置:
激活插件后,进入插件的设置页,找到CDN选项。 根据使用的CDN服务商提供的设置说明,输入CDN URL等必要参数。
配置CDN服务商设置
获取CDN URL:在CDN提供商的管理界面中获取CDN分配的专属URL。 DNS设置(可选):部分服务商需要用户在域名服务商处调整DNS设置,这可能涉及添加CNAME记录等操作。
缓存和同步设置
数据缓存设置:在CDN服务商后台配置缓存规则,定义哪些文件需要缓存、缓存的时长等。 文件同步:确保所有静态资源文件(如图像、CSS、JavaScript)已正确同步到CDN服务器。
测试与验证
清空本地缓存:完成以上步骤后,返回WordPress缓存插件设置页面清空所有缓存。 访问并测试:访问网站多个页面,验证CDN是否正常工作,页面加载速度是否有所提高。 工具检查:使用在线网站速度测试工具(如GTmetrix或Google PageSpeed Insights)查看CDN是否正常参与了资源加载。
常见问题及解决方案 在CDN应用中,可能会遭遇一些问题,通常可通过下面的方法解决。
CDN未正常加载资源
检查CDN URL:确认在WordPress插件设置中输入的CDN URL是否正确。 Verify SSL配合:确保CDN和网站主机均支持SSL(HTTPS),并在插件中启用相关支持设置。
缓存未更新或显示旧内容
清除CDN缓存:在CDN服务后台清除缓存,以确保最新内容得到分发。 修改缓存策略:调整CDN缓存规则,减少缓存旧数据的可能性。
部分内容加载失败
检查文件权限:确保所有需缓存的文件在源服务器上都有正确的访问权限。 逐步排除法:使用浏览器调试工具查看加载失败资源的具体错误信息,以作针对性修改。
WordPress集成CDN的**实践
选择适宜的CDN插件和服务商组合:每种插件及服务有不同优势,应结合网站性质量体裁衣。 定期监测网站性能:结合Google Analytics等工具,持续关注网站性能以确保CDN效果。 结合其他优化技术:CDN是网站优化的一部分,可与Lazy Load技术等结合使用,最大化提升用户体验。
WordPress建站公司数智易的服务简介 数智易致力于为企业和个人客户提供高质量的WordPress建站服务,涵盖网站设计开发、性能优化、安全管理等多项内容。专业的解决方案旨在帮助客户打造出功能齐全且符合品牌形象的在线平台。依托丰富的行业经验,我们为客户提供从解决方案定制到长期维护的全面支持,确保每一个WordPress项目都能快速上线、稳定运营。
通过本文所述,站长们可以依据指导,在自己的WordPress网站中成功配置和利用CDN技术,从而显著提升用户体验和网站性能。
你可能还喜欢下面这些文章